witch-names-that-start-with-c

You May Like

The Witch's Name: Crafting Identities Of Magical Power
The Witch's Name: Crafting Identities Of Magical Power

$15.69

View Details
The Witch's Name: Crafting Identities of Magical Power
The Witch's Name: Crafting Identities of Magical Power

$20.74

View Details